Output 1725494c8aecf08268c25ce23769737ede990639e189a9e053a79c6181b04c37:0

value
1600627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 993d9b65dd62901b5c0e55ee32afc9489446191a OP_EQUAL
address
3FfH7RbL5grdCerjxJb3Wf77anoHd3TS4U
transaction
1725494c8aecf08268c25ce23769737ede990639e189a9e053a79c6181b04c37
confirmations
254051
spent
true